A Red Hill Lady Saluki has received a postseason honor from the Illinois Basketball Coaches Association (IBCA).
Senior Caitlee Gray was named to the Special Mention Team by IBCA representatives at the All-State selection meeting held on March 5.
Gray led Red Hill to an 11-11 record. She was atop the Saluki stat sheet with 17 points per game. She also led the team in rebounding (8.4 / game), steals (2.3) and blocks (1.3).
The 5'9" Gray has committed to play at the next level at Olney Central College.
Gray joined her teammate Riley Moore in earning Midland Trail honors. Gray was named First Team All-Conference. Meanwhile, Moore was named Honorable Mention All-Conference. Moore was second on the team in scoring (7.2 ppg) and led the Lady Salukis in steals (2.4 / game).
